You can delete your Master Mental Ability account and your practice data at any time, and you do not need to have the app installed to ask. There are two ways.

Two ways to do it

1

In the app — immediate

Open Settings, choose Delete account, and confirm. It happens straight away and you are signed out.

This is the fastest route and it needs nothing from us.

2

By writing to us — no app needed

Email hello@mastermentalability.in with the subject Delete my account, and tell us the mobile number the account is registered to. That is the only thing we need.

We will verify that the request comes from the account holder, delete it, and write back to confirm. We do this within 7 days, and usually the same day.

If you are a parent or guardian asking for a child's account to be removed, write to us the same way and say so. You do not need the app or the password.

What is kept, and why

Two things outlive the account, and in both cases your name, number and email are removed from them first — what is left cannot be traced back to you by us or by anybody else.

WhatStatusWhy
Payment records kept If you ever paid us, the record of that payment — the amount and the date, without you attached to it — has to survive, so a tax question or a disputed charge a year later can still be answered.
Reports of a broken question kept If you told us a question was wrong, that report stays so the question can be fixed, with you cut out of it. The fault is in our content, not in you, and it must not leave when you do.

If another student used your referral link before you left, the free days they earned stay with them. Their account is theirs, not yours, and nothing in it names you afterwards.

This cannot be undone

There is no recovery period and no restore. Your practice history, your review schedule and your progress are gone for good. If you have paid for access, deleting your account does not refund it and does not carry it to a new account. If you only want to stop the reminders, turn them off in Settings instead — that leaves your practice where it is.
